Streamline Design Workflows
Discover how automating design workflows with scripts can boost efficiency and productivity in batch SVG processing
Introduction to Automated Design Workflows
As designers, we're constantly looking for ways to streamline our workflows and boost productivity. One often overlooked aspect of design is the potential for automation. By leveraging scripts, designers can automate repetitive tasks, freeing up more time for creative work. In this article, we'll delve into the world of automating design workflows, focusing on batch SVG processing.
The Benefits of Automation
Automating design workflows offers numerous benefits, including increased efficiency, reduced errors, and enhanced scalability. By automating tasks such as SVG optimization, designers can process large batches of files quickly and accurately, without the need for manual intervention. This not only saves time but also reduces the risk of human error, ensuring that files are processed consistently and to a high standard.
Real-World Applications of Automation
So, how can automation be applied in real-world design scenarios? One common use case is in the processing of large batches of SVG files. For example, a designer working on a branding project may need to optimize and export hundreds of SVG files in different formats. By using a script to automate this process, the designer can save hours of manual work and focus on higher-level creative tasks.
Tools for Automation
There are several tools available for automating design workflows, including Tools like Figma and Illustrator, which offer built-in scripting capabilities. Additionally, external tools like PNG2SVG can be used to convert raster images to vector formats, which can then be automated using scripts. By leveraging these tools, designers can create custom workflows tailored to their specific needs.
Creating Automated Workflows
So, how do you get started with creating automated workflows? The first step is to identify repetitive tasks that can be automated. This might include tasks such as file optimization, formatting, or export. Once you've identified these tasks, you can begin to explore the scripting capabilities of your design tools. Many design tools offer built-in scripting languages, such as JavaScript or Visual Basic, which can be used to create custom scripts.
Tips for Successful Automation
When creating automated workflows, there are several tips to keep in mind. First, start small and focus on automating a single task or process. This will help you build confidence and expertise, and allow you to refine your workflow before scaling up. Second, be sure to test your scripts thoroughly to ensure they're working as intended. This will help you catch any errors or bugs, and prevent issues downstream.
Case Study: Automating SVG Optimization
A great example of automation in action is the optimization of SVG files. By using a script to automate the optimization process, designers can ensure that their SVG files are optimized for web use, without having to manually process each file. This not only saves time but also ensures consistency across the board. For instance, a designer working on an e-commerce website might use a script to automate the optimization of product icons, ensuring that all icons are optimized for fast loading times and crisp display.
Conclusion and Next Steps
In conclusion, automating design workflows with scripts offers a powerful way to boost efficiency and productivity in batch SVG processing. By leveraging tools like Figma and Illustrator, and external tools like PNG2SVG, designers can create custom workflows tailored to their specific needs. Whether you're looking to automate repetitive tasks or simply streamline your workflow, automation is definitely worth exploring. So why not get started today? Identify a task or process that can be automated, and begin building your own custom workflow. With a little practice and patience, you'll be streamlining your design workflow in no time.